09:04 EDTBABell Boeing awarded contract for 99 V-22 Osprey tiltrotor aircraft
The Bell Boeing V-22 Program, a strategic alliance between Bell Helicopter Textron (TXT) and Boeing (TXT) has been awarded a five-year U.S. Naval Air Systems Command contract for the production and delivery of 99 V-22 Osprey tiltrotor aircraft, including 92 MV-22 models for the U.S. Marine Corps and seven CV-22 models for the U.S. Air Force Special Operations Command. Valued at approximately $6.5B, the contract is structured to provide nearly $1B in savings to the U.S. government compared with procurements through single-year contracts. The contract also includes a provision permitting NAVAIR to order up to 23 additional aircraft.
08:32 EDTLMT, NOCLONGBOW receives $90M contract for Saudi Arabia Apache radar systems
The LONGBOW Limited Liability Company, a joint venture of Lockheed Martin (LMT) and Northrop Grumman (NOC), received a $90.6M contract to provide Saudi Arabia with LONGBOW Fire Control Radars for the AH-64 Apache Attack Helicopter. The contract award includes AH-64E LONGBOW FCRs, spares and support for the Royal Saudi Land Forces Aviation Command. The contract also includes LONGBOW FCRs for the Saudi Arabia National Guard and LONGBOW Mast Mounted Assemblies for the U.S. Army.

06:47 EDTBABoeing raises long-term plane demand forecast, Reuters reports
Boeing increased its outlook for the amount of new planes that will be needed over the next 20 years to 24,670, according to Reuters. Last year the company had predicted that 23,240 new planes would be needed over the next two decades, the news service stated. Reference Link

10:31 EDTLMTLockheed Martin receives $34M foreign military sales contract
Lockheed Martin received a $34.2M foreign military sales contract from the U.S. Air Force to support additional integration of the Joint Air-to-Surface Standoff Missile onto the Finnish Air Force F-18C/D aircraft. Finland is the second international customer for JASSM. This second contract for Finland includes test missiles, software development and engineering documentation.
